I've been having a small problem with the Red Hair Algae in my tank, my Devils hand kept closing everytime the red algae wud grow on it. I kept peeling off the algae so the devils hand wud open up again, for a while I didn't take the algae off and noticed it was closed so I put the devils hand in front of my return line so the current cud blow away the red algae and the devils hand kinda fell apart, almost disentergrating, Now half of it is still on the rock and the other half is gone...should I throw away the rest of the coral or will it survive........ ![]()

Is it still intact? If its still falling apart, just get rid of it before it fouls up your tank. If the part thats left is solid, give it a chance. But for a leather to fall apart somethign had to be wrong in the tank thats not making it happy. So that parts gonna have a hard time surviving if what ever is wrong doesnt get fixed.
